Output d12913777f3fde5091e360346bac44c569e849fad9f39b3eae45fcafec1f0826:1

value
25470815
script pubkey
OP_0 OP_PUSHBYTES_20 b6159b6bbca8031ef3de894e84ffd89bf7a3f42d
address
bc1qkc2ek6au4qp3au77398gfl7cn0m68apdc75ntk
transaction
d12913777f3fde5091e360346bac44c569e849fad9f39b3eae45fcafec1f0826
confirmations
176245
spent
true